COHEN, Alfred
Personal Details
Service Number: | 6228 |
---|---|
Enlisted: | 7 September 1915, Liverpool, NSW |
Last Rank: | Private |
Last Unit: | 23rd Infantry Battalion |
Born: | Orange, New South Wales, Australia, 1889 |
Home Town: | Goodooga, Brewarrina, New South Wales |
Schooling: | Not yet discovered |
Occupation: | School Teacher |
Died: | Sydney, NSW, Australia, 17 August 1968, cause of death not yet discovered |
Cemetery: |
Rookwood Cemeteries & Crematorium, New South Wales The New South Wales Garden of Remembrance |
Memorials: | Hereford House Reunion Club Roll of Honour, New South Wales Garden of Remembrance (Rookwood Necropolis) |
